GREEN BAY, Wis.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Jun 9, 2025--

KI is proud to announce its success at this year’s Best of NeoCon awards competition, with one of its newest innovations receiving Silver honors at North America’s most prestigious commercial interiors awards program. This recognition reinforces KI’s commitment to thoughtful, flexible and forward-thinking design solutions for today’s evolving learning, working and healing environments.

Designed with ergonomic comfort and motion in mind, Cogni encourages natural movement to promote student engagement and focus.

“We are incredibly honored to be recognized by the Best of NeoCon judges for the Cogni Classroom Chair,” said Tony Besasie, chief marketing and sales officer at KI. “The Best of NeoCon Silver Award validates the passion and purpose our design and engineering teams bring to each product we develop. Every piece reflects KI’s belief in creating intelligent, adaptable solutions that meet the real needs of our customers across industries.”

Cogni™ classroom seating redefines the student experience with intuitive support, durable construction and the flexibility required in today’s active learning spaces. Designed with ergonomic comfort and motion in mind, Cogni encourages natural movement to promote student engagement and focus.

“With Cogni, we set out to rethink what classroom seating could be,” said Besasie. “We know that movement is essential to focus and learning. Cogni encourages that movement—offering intuitive comfort that adapts to the learner, not the other way around. It’s a thoughtful response to how students truly engage in today’s classrooms.”

This recognition comes as KI marks its final NeoCon showcase at The Mart before moving to its new showroom in Fulton Market in 2026.

“As we reflect on our legacy at The Mart and look ahead to our future at Fulton Market, it is especially meaningful to be honored this year,” said Besasie. “This moment encapsulates KI’s evolution, rooted in design excellence and always looking forward.”

ABOUT KI

KI manufactures innovative furniture for education, healthcare, government and corporate markets. The employee-owned company is headquartered in Green Bay, Wisconsin, with sales and manufacturing facilities worldwide. KI tailors products and service solutions to the specific needs of each customer through its unique design and manufacturing philosophy. For more information, visit ki.com.
